SEO
It’s not just onsite SEO that matters when it comes to getting your business noticed online. In fact, off-site SEO is essential too. This being where you have links to your website embedded in sites other than your own.
Do be careful here, though, because you obviously want such links to be placed in reputable sites and ones that are as popular as possible. The reason being that this is the kind of information the SEO bots will be looking for and so can affect where you end up in the SERPs.

Social Media
Finally, if you want to get your business noticed online, you need to utilise social media. In fact, there are several reasons why sites like Facebook and Instagram are useful here. The first being that you can encourage customer engagement by asking their opinions and creating a real sense of community around your product.
Then, there is the fact that you can use social media platforms as a way to provide fast, personal, and effective customer support. Something that will not only make sure your current customers are kept happy but that can also show other potentials how well you look after them too. Therefore, helping to build a positive reputation online that is sure to get you noticed.
